Output 665e21658b3dfc58f2ea4c2c6269de0f93d350f3362e55d9e9c132a2b6412ca5: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7348881a7f6b92e088b456d215408a2a9738a091 OP_EQUAL
address
DFef8uYA4CS3nCoUR1RBdG6rDSPZNtmJ5W
transaction
665e21658b3dfc58f2ea4c2c6269de0f93d350f3362e55d9e9c132a2b6412ca5
spent
true